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A polyalkylene carbonate resin composition with interpenetrating network structure includes an aliphatic polycarbonate obtained through a reaction of carbon dioxide with at least one epoxide compound selected from the group consisting of (C2-C10)alkylene oxide substituted or unsubstituted with halogen or alkoxy, (C4-C20)cycloalkylene oxide substituted or unsubstituted with halogen or alkoxy, and (C8-C20)styrene oxide substituted or unsubstituted with halogen, alkoxy, alkyl or aryl, at least one compound selected from a polyol compound, an epoxy compound and an acryl compound, and a curing agent for polymerization or networking.

What is claimed is: 1. A resin composition comprising an interpenetrating polymer network comprising: (a) an aliphatic polycarbonate having a weight average molecular weight between 30,000 and 350,000, obtained through a reaction of carbon dioxide with at least one epoxide compound selected from the group consisting of (C2-C10)alkylene oxide substituted or unsubstituted with halogen or alkoxy; (C4-C20)cycloalkylene oxide substituted or unsubstituted with halogen or alkoxy; and (C8-C20)styrene oxide substituted or unsubstituted with halogen, alkoxy, alkyl or aryl, wherein the aliphatic polycarbonate is represented by Chemical Formula 1: wherein in Chemical Formula 1, w is an integer of 2 to 10, x is an integer of 5 to 100, y is an integer of 0 to 100, n is an integer of 1 to 3, and R is hydrogen, (C1-C4)alkyl or —CH 2 —O—R′ (R′ is (C1-C8)alkyl); and (b) the reaction product of: (i) a polyol compound having a weight average molecular weight between 200 and 30,000; and (ii) a curing agent having functional groups capable of reacting with hydroxyl functional groups of the polyol compound to form the reaction product, wherein the reaction product is penetrated into the aliphatic polycarbonate to form an interpenetrating network. 2. The resin composition of claim 1 , wherein the aliphatic polycarbonate has a melt index (150° C./5 kg) between 0.01 and 350. 3. The resin composition of claim 1 , wherein the aliphatic polycarbonate is polypropylene carbonate or polyethylene carbonate. 4. The resin composition of claim 1 , wherein the polyol compound is at least one selected from the group consisting of polyester polyol, polyether polyol and polycarbonate polyol. 5. The resin composition of claim 1 , wherein the curing agent is at least one selected from an isocyanate-based compound, a melamine-based compound, an amine-based compound, an acid anhydride-based compound, an imidazole-based compound and a mercaptan-based compound. 6. The res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the isocyanate-based compound is at least one selected from the group consisting of 2,4-trilene diisocyanate, 2,6-trilene diisocyanate, hydrogenated trilene diisocyanate, 1,3-xylene diisocyanate, 1,4-xylene diisocyanate, diphenyl methane-4,4-diisocyanate, 1,3-bisisocyanatomethyl cyclohexane, tetramethyl xylene diisocyanate, 1,5-naphthalene diisocyanate, 2,2,4-trimethyl hexamethylene diisocyanate, 2,4,4-trimethyl hexamethylene diisocyanate and triphenylmethane triisocyanate. 7. The polyalkylene carbonate res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the melamine-based curing ag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of hexa methoxy methyl melamine, hexa ethoxy methyl melamine, hexa propoxy methyl melamine, hexa butoxy methyl melamine, hexa pentyloxy methyl melamine and hexa hexyloxy methyl melamine. 8. The polyalkylene carbonate res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the amine-based curing ag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of benzyldimethyl amine, triethanol amine, triethylene tetramine, diethylene triamine, triethylene amine, dimethylaminoethanol, and tridimethylaminomethylphenol. 9. The polyalkylene carbonate res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the acid anhydride curing ag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of phthalic anhydride, maleic anhydride, trimellitic anhydride, pyromellitic anhydride, hexahydrophthalic anhydride, tetrahydrophthalic anhydride, methylnadic anhydride, nadic anhydride and methylhexahydrophthalic anhydride. 10. The polyalkylene carbonate res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the imidazole-based curing ag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of imidazole, isoimidazole, 2-methylimidazole, 2-ethyl-4-methylimidazole, 2,4-dimethylimidazole, butylimidazole, 2-heptadecenyl-4-methylimidazole, 2-methylimidazole, 2-undecenylimidazole, 1-vinyl-2-methylimidazole, 2-n-heptadecylimidazole, 2-undecylimidazole, 2-heptadecylimidazole, 2-phenylimidazole, 1-benzyl-2-methylimidazole, 1-propyl-2-methylimidazole, 1-cyanoethyl-2-methylimidazole, 1-cyanoethyl-2-ethyl-4-methylimidazole, 1-cyanoethyl-2-undecylimidazole, 1-cyanoethyl-2-phenylimidazole, 1-guanaminoethyl-2-methylimidazole, an added product of the imidazole and methylimidazole, an added product of the imidazole and trimellitic acid, 2-n-heptadecyl-4-methylimidazole, phenylimidazole, benzylimidazole, 2-methyl-4,5-diphenylimidazole, 2,3,5-triphenylimidazole, 2-styrylimidazole, 1-(dodecylbenzyl)-2-methylimidazole, 2-(2-hydroxyl-4-t-butylphenyl)-4,5-diphenylimidazole, 2-(2-methoxyphenyl)-4,5-diphenylimidazole, 2-(3-hydroxyphenyl)-4,5-diphenylimidazole, 2-(p-dimethyl-aminophenyl)-4,5-diphenylimidazole, 2-(2-hydroxyphenyl)-4,5-diphenylimidazole, di(4,5-diphenyl-2-imidazole)-benzyl-1,4,2-naphthyl-4,5-diphenylimidazole, 1-benzyl-2-methylimidazole, and 2-p-methoxystyrylimidazole. 11. The polyalkylene carbonate res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the mercaptan-based curing ag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of pentaerythritol, tetrathio glycol, polysulfide, and trioxane trimethylene mercaptan. 12. The resin composition of claim 1 , comprising 5 to 950 parts by weight of the polyol compound with respect to 100 parts by weight of the aliphatic polycarbonate, and 0.9 to 1.2 times of equivalents of the curing agent with respect to hydroxy equivalent of the polyol polymer. 13. The resin composition of claim 5 , wherein the isocyanate-based curing agent and the melamine-based curing agent are included in a reaction one by one. 14. The resin composition of claim 1 , further comprising at least one additive selected from the group consisting of a pigment, a dye, a filler, an anti-oxidant, an ultraviolet blocking agent, an antistatic agent, a blocking preventing agent, a slipping agent, an inorganic filler, a mixing agent, a stabilizer, a viscosity imparting resin, a modifying resin, a leveling agent, a fluorescent whitening agent, a dispersing agent, a thermal stabilizer, a light stabilizer, an ultraviolet absorbent and a lubricant. 15. A molded product comprising the resin composition of claim 1 .
